Loading... # 引言 自JDK1.8后,jvisualvm就不再随着jdk打包发布了,如果需要这个工具,需要自己安装。 ![image.png](https://www.zunmx.top/usr/uploads/2023/09/2372452268.png) # 下载地址 [visualvm-github](https://github.com/oracle/visualvm/) [visualvm-官网](https://visualvm.github.io/index.html) # 启动报错 报错信息如下所示 > Cannot find Java1.8 or higher > ![image.png](https://www.zunmx.top/usr/uploads/2023/09/1506485933.png) JAVA_HOME和path都配置好了,但是还是出现这个问题,所以看下etc中有没有jdk的配置项 在etc/visualvm.conf中发现了`visualvm_jdkhome`,所以配置到JDK目录即可。 ![image.png](https://www.zunmx.top/usr/uploads/2023/09/2798217721.png) # 插件安装 ![image.png](https://www.zunmx.top/usr/uploads/2023/09/876284925.png) ![image.png](https://www.zunmx.top/usr/uploads/2023/09/2115554798.png) # 注意 JDK8中自带的是中文的,但是最新版的没有语言包,所以介意的还是搞个1.8的jdk,提取出来jvisualvm,基本上是通用的,也就是说,JDK8中的jvisualvm,可以用在JDK11甚至是17的应用上。 © 允许规范转载 打赏 赞赏作者 支付宝微信 赞 如果觉得我的文章对你有用,请随意赞赏